Archer Daniels Total Value Analysis

Archer Daniels Midland is presently forecasted to have company total value of 32.8 B with market capitalization of 22.11 B, debt of 10.16 B, and cash on hands of 1.04 B. Please note that company total value may be misleading and is a subject to accounting gimmicks. We encourage investors to carefully check all of the Archer Daniels fundamentals before making security assessment based on enterprise value of the company

Archer Daniels Asset Utilization

The asset utilization indicator refers to the revenue earned for every dollar of assets a company currently reports. Archer Daniels has an asset utilization ratio of 160.56 percent. This suggests that the Company is making $1.61 for each dollar of assets. An increasing asset utilization means that Archer Daniels Midland is more efficient with each dollar of assets it utilizes for everyday operations.

Archer Daniels Profitability Analysis

The company reported the last year's revenue of 85.53 B. Total Income to common stockholders was 1.78 B with profit before taxes, overhead, and interest of 5.78 B.

There are various types of dividends Archer Daniels can pay to its shareholders, and the actual value of the dividend is determined on a per-share basis. It is to be paid equally to all of Archer shareholders on a specific date, known as the payable date. The cash dividend is the most common type of dividend payment - it is the payment of actual cash from Archer Daniels Midland directly to its shareholders. There are other types of dividends that companies can issue, such as stock dividends or asset dividends. When Archer pays a dividend, it has no impact on its enterprise value. It does, however, lowers the Equity Value of Archer Daniels by the value of the dividends paid out.
